Frederick Griffith's experiments involved two strains of Streptococcus pneumoniae: a virulent smooth strain (S) with a polysaccharide capsule and a non-virulent rough strain (R) without the capsule.
Griffith observed that when he injected mice with the live R strain and heat-killed S strain, the mice developed pneumonia and died, and live S strain bacteria were found in their bodies.
This suggested that some 'transforming principle' from the heat-killed S strain was taken up by the R strain, converting it into the virulent S strain.
Griffith's conclusion was that this 'transforming principle' was responsible for transferring genetic information, although he did not identify it as DNA.
Later experiments by Avery, MacLeod, and McCarty identified DNA as the 'transforming principle,' confirming Griffith's findings and establishing DNA as the molecule responsible for heredity.
